For more Wake tips, news, and brand deep-dives, be sure to check out \u003ca href=\"https:\/\/welcomeboardstore.com.au\/blogs\/news\" target=\"_blank\"\u003eThe Welcome Journal\u003c\/a\u003e.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Ronix","offers":[{"title":"134 \/ Metallic \/ Red","offer_id":41603298984039,"sku":"840298227112","price":749.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true},{"title":"138 \/ Metallic \/ Red","offer_id":41603299016807,"sku":"840298227129","price":749.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true},{"title":"144 \/ Metallic \/ Red","offer_id":41603299049575,"sku":"840298227136","price":749.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true},{"title":"150 \/ Metallic \/ Red","offer_id":41603299082343,"sku":"840298227143","price":749.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0049\/4426\/5319\/files\/RONIXWAKEBOARDSDISTRICTBOTH.png?v=1759026291"},{"product_id":"2027-ronix-vault-wakeboard","title":"2027 Ronix Vault Wakeboard","description":"\u003ch2 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e2027 Ronix Vault Wakeboard | The Building Block To Your Wakeboarding\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eThe \u003cb\u003e2027 Ronix Vault\u003c\/b\u003e is the board most people should learn on, and the reason is a design decision Ronix made over twenty years ago: your shoulders and hips are not parallel when you wakeboard. You're crossed up toe-side and inline heel-side, so the two edges of the board shouldn't be identical. The Vault isn't. That asymmetry is what makes the first season click instead of drag.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eKey Technical Features\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eAsymmetrical Rails And Molded-In Fins:\u003c\/b\u003e A more vertical sidewall with shorter moulded-in fins on the heel-side edge, for glide and a quicker release. A longer moulded-in fin and a sharper rail toe-side, where you need the hold. The tail washing out on a toe edge is the classic beginner frustration, and this is the shape that stops it.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eMost Naturally Centred Rocker Line:\u003c\/b\u003e Drawn to be ridden with neutral weight distribution. You stand relaxed and balanced rather than being asked to load the tail, which is exactly what you want while you're still thinking about your feet.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e3-Stage Rocker:\u003c\/b\u003e A later arc with more angle at the tip and tail. It gives a vertical kick off the wake, and even behind a smaller boat you'll feel a solid pop rather than nothing at all.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eNeutral Energy, Rated 4:\u003c\/b\u003e Consistent rather than explosive. The board does the same thing every time you hit the wake, which is the single most useful trait when you're learning something new.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eModello Core:\u003c\/b\u003e A lighter core and glass layup that cuts swingweight without going so soft the board loses its consistency underfoot.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eTwo 1.75\" Hook Fins:\u003c\/b\u003e The moulded-in fins do most of the holding, so the removable Hooks are there to be pulled as your edging sharpens and you want the board looser.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eWhy You'll Love It\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eEntry level to intermediate, and that's the honest ceiling. Once you're clearing the wake consistently and want a rockerline that carries speed across the flats, the District is the hybrid step up. Until then the Vault is the board that gets you standing, then carving, then jumping, without punishing you along the way. It runs 130 through 145, so it also covers the whole family rather than just the biggest rider in the boat.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eSize Guide\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e130 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ders up to 57 kg · 2.4\" rocker · 757 sq in surface area · 16.4\" centre width · 19–25\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e135 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ders up to 75 kg · 2.5\" rocker · 787 sq in surface area · 16.7\" centre width · 19.5–25.5\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e140 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ders 66–84 kg · 2.6\" rocker · 836 sq in surface area · 16.9\" centre width · 21–27\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e145 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ders 77–95 kg · 2.7\" rocker · 875 sq in surface area · 17.0\" centre width · 22–28\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eWhere two lengths overlap on rider weight, the shorter board spins and presses easier and the longer one lands softer and holds more speed.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eBuy Now at Welcome Boardstore for the best in authentic Wake gear and apparel. The engineering problem was an old one — riders want a stiff, reactive take-off but a soft landing, and those two things fight each other. Pretension fibreglass is Ronix's answer, and the data coming back off the water is hard to argue with.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eKey Technical Features\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003ePretension Fiberglass:\u003c\/b\u003e As the laminates go into the mould, the fibres are pulled tight — pre-loading the glass so it's already primed to release. Normally you wait for the board to react to the energy of the wake before it recoils. Here it's ready the moment you edge in. Ronix are recording up to 21% more flight time.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eBlackout Core:\u003c\/b\u003e The most connected core in the range. Feedback comes straight up through your feet, so you always know what the board is doing underneath you — the difference between guessing at a trick and committing to it.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eContinuous Rocker:\u003c\/b\u003e Smooth, predictable take-offs and speed that never stalls through the flats. You carry momentum off the wake rather than getting popped straight up, which is what puts you deep into the landing zone. It steps up gently with length — 2.4\" on the 136 through to 2.7\" on the 148.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eInstant Energy Construction:\u003c\/b\u003e A quicker way to generate lift off the wake. Load the line and the board answers immediately instead of asking you to wait for it.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eForgiving Shape:\u003c\/b\u003e A lenient outline that corrects itself when you land off-target. It won't punish a slightly nose-heavy landing — which is exactly what you want on a board you're learning new tricks on.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eFin Setup:\u003c\/b\u003e Four 1.0\" Ramp fins and four 0.8\" Free Agent fins. Run them loose for a surfy, slidey feel or lock it in for hard edge hold — the board changes personality depending on how you set it up.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eWhy You'll Love It\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eThis is an advanced boat board and we'll be straight with you — it's not a first wakeboard. If you're still working on getting up consistently or you haven't started clearing the wake, your money is better spent on a Vault or a District. The RXT is for riders who already have air time and want more of it: progressive riders carrying real momentum, sending it wake-to-wake, and landing further into the flats than they could last season. Fast, light and forgiving, with a construction that genuinely moves the needle rather than a new graphic on last year's board.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eSize Guide\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e136 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ders up to 77 kg · 2.4\" rocker · 807 sq in surface area · 16.8\" centre width · 21.5–25.5\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e140 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ders 70–89 kg · 2.5\" rocker · 857 sq in surface area · 17.0\" centre width · 22.5–26.5\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e144 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ders 75–93 kg · 2.6\" rocker · 867 sq in surface area · 17.2\" centre width · 23.5–27.5\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e148 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ders 82 kg and up · 2.7\" rocker · 873 sq in surface area · 17.2\" centre width · 23.5–27.5\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eWhere two lengths overlap on rider weight, the shorter board spins and presses easier and the longer one lands softer and holds more speed.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eBuy Now at Welcome Boardstore for the best in authentic Wake gear and apparel. For more Wake tips, news, and brand deep-dives, be sure to check out \u003ca href=\"https:\/\/welcomeboardstore.com.au\/blogs\/news\" target=\"_blank\"\u003eThe Welcome Journal\u003c\/a\u003e.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Ronix","offers":[{"title":"134 \/ Midnight Shine","offer_id":44467370688615,"sku":"840298234011","price":1399.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true},{"title":"138 \/ Midnight Shine","offer_id":44467370721383,"sku":"840298234028","price":1399.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true},{"title":"142 \/ Midnight Shine","offer_id":44467370754151,"sku":"840298234035","price":1399.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true},{"title":"146 \/ Midnight Shine","offer_id":44467370786919,"sku":"840298234042","price":1399.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0049\/4426\/5319\/files\/b1-04.jpg?v=1787380244"},{"product_id":"2027-ronix-parks-wakeboard","title":"2027 Ronix Parks Wakeboard","description":"\u003ch2 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e2027 Ronix Parks Wakeboard | Snowboard Thinking, Applied to Water\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eThe \u003cb\u003e2027 Ronix Parks\u003c\/b\u003e is the easiest-riding high-end board in wakeboarding, and it gets there by borrowing from two places nobody else looks — golf and snowboarding. Hexagon dimples through the base cut water friction, and tip and tail arcs sit independent of the rocker line. Parks Bonifay's signature series is built around a simple idea: ride longer, work less, keep doing this for years.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eKey Technical Features\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eHexagon Dimpled Base:\u003c\/b\u003e Lifted straight from golf ball design. The dimples reduce water friction across the whole bottom of the board, so it breaks free into cutbacks in a way nothing else does.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eTip and Tail Arcs:\u003c\/b\u003e Angles built into the nose and tail, independent of the rocker. Press the nose or tail on the water, blunt off the top of the wave — and just as usefully, get a smoother transition up the wake and a much bigger sweet spot to land in.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eModello Core:\u003c\/b\u003e Ronix's forgiving core. Soaks up mistakes rather than punishing them.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eContinuous Rocker:\u003c\/b\u003e Easy take-off with real glide speed, so there's less strain on your body over a long set. Reduced side cut and added volume make it genuinely easy at slower boat speeds.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eFin Setup:\u003c\/b\u003e Four 1.0\" Ramp and four 0.8\" Free Agent fins.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eWhy You'll Love It\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eThis is the board for intermediate and advanced riders who want a high-end feel without a high-end board's demands — and for anyone whose body is telling them they can't keep charging as hard as they did at twenty. Chop on the lake and whitewash on the wake stop being a problem; it cruises through both like a snowboard through crud. If you're chasing maximum vertical air, the One or RXT will get you higher. If you want to ride all afternoon and still enjoy the last set, take the Parks.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eSize Guide\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e138 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ders up to 75 kg · 2.4\"\/3.5\" rocker · 818 sq in surface area · 16.9\" centre width · 21.5–25.5\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e143 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ders 66–84 kg · 2.5\"\/3.6\" rocker · 860 sq in surface area · 17.1\" centre width · 23–27\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003cli\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003e148 cm:\u003c\/b\u003e riders 77 kg and up · 2.6\"\/3.7\" rocker · 902 sq in surface area · 17.3\" centre width · 24–28\" stance\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eWhere two lengths overlap on rider weight, the shorter board spins and presses easier and the longer one lands softer and holds more speed.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003eBuy Now at Welcome Boardstore for the best in authentic Wake gear and apparel.
